Fact check: Images of Saturn, Jupiter are real, taken from Massachusetts telescope – USA TODAY
Viral photo posted to social media upon the conjunction of Jupiter and Saturn was captured via telescope in Massachusetts, using a special technique.

Jupiter and Saturn were nearest Dec. 21, but they’ll remain very close through Dec. 24. Video shot from Mitchel Telescope at Cincinnati Observatory.
Cincinnati Enquirer
The claim: Image shows conjunction of Saturn and Jupiter
A viral image shared to Facebook purports to show the convergence of Jupiter and Saturn, in which the two planets appeared closer to each other than they have in centuries.
“Best photo I have seen of the conjunction of Jupiter & Saturn taken from an observatory in Chile,” reads…
